GOING TO CASABLANCA, CHILE
It was a truly magical day!
We left very early from Santiago to the ranch "El Cuadro" which is in Casablanca, Chile.
The day was sunny and out of route 68 we went on a country road surrounded by trees and later by vineyards
We entered the vineyard, with a beautiful fountain, a huge building like an Italian villa,
surrounded by acres and acres of vineyards, all bright green, with flower gardens, hills covered with trees and blue sky, was really wonderful.
They also have a gallery where they show the complete process from the cluster of grapes to wine.
With statues, and huge wooden barrels.
